In 2011, Veridicus Health implemented Intuit Quickbooks Enterprise as its ERP Financial system. The deployment centralized core financial processing for the 40-employee United States healthcare firm, establishing Intuit Quickbooks Enterprise as the primary accounting platform for billing, receivables, payables and reporting. Implementation focused on configuring the chart of accounts and transaction controls to support routine accounting operations and month-end close workflows. Configuration work emphasized general ledger, accounts payable, accounts receivable and operational reporting modules typical of an ERP Financial deployment, with role-based access applied to finance users and administrative staff. Operational processes retained heavy use of Excel, with staff leveraging QuickBooks export and import workflows to perform reconciliations and ad hoc analysis. Governance included defined close checklists and control points embedded in day-to-day bookkeeping processes, aligning accounting procedures with healthcare billing and revenue recognition needs.

In 2015, Veridicus Health implemented Microsoft 365 as its Collaboration platform. The 40 employee United States healthcare firm deployed Microsoft 365 from Microsoft to provide cloud-hosted productivity services, with the company website leveraging Microsoft 365 for contact and email workflows. The deployment targeted core office productivity and external communication capabilities to support clinical administration and small business operations. Implementation emphasized standard Microsoft 365 functional modules including Exchange Online email, SharePoint and OneDrive document storage and collaboration, and Teams messaging and meetings to support back office and administrative workflows. The environment was provisioned as a Microsoft cloud tenant with centralized user provisioning and cloud identity management to control access across departments. Configuration work included mailbox hosting, document collaboration sites, and embedded site contact processes tied to the public website. Governance focused on tenant administration, role based access controls, and adoption of Microsoft 365 collaboration workflows across the organization.
